Fairhaven Runner’s Waterfront 15K beautiful start

<< Back to archives | Saturday, September 13, 2008

Starting for the first time from the heart of the Historic District in Fairhaven, almost 700 runners and walkers started in bright sunshine at 8:45 this morning.  This scenic race goes along the Fairhaven and Bellingham waterfronts for almost 5 miles and then returns on a slightly different route closer to the water.  Yes, it uses the popular Taylor Dock for the return leg.  The race was the idea of Steve Roguski, owner of Fairhaven Runners & Walkers, a couple years ago.  It is now well accepted as an annual mid September event.  You can just see the shop on the far left of the photo.  This view looks south on 11th Street towards the intersection of Harris Avenue where the race started.
